MAL-2026-6584: Malicious code in poly-kelly (npm)
0

The poly-kelly npm package version 3.5.3 contains malicious code that executes during installation. Its postinstall script fetches a JSON configuration from a remote URL, downloads and extracts a tarball containing JavaScript code, then executes that code without any integrity verification. The remote URL can be overridden and downgraded from HTTPS to HTTP, enabling man-in-the-middle injection of arbitrary code. The package metadata lacks typical author and repository information and uses the homepage field as a command-and-control configuration endpoint, indicating it is a disposable dropper designed for remote code execution at install time.
